Israel bars nuclear whistle-blower from emigrating


Mordechai Vanunu



Israel's supreme court on Thursday barred nuclear whistle-blower Mordechai Vanunu from emigrating on the grounds he still poses a threat to state security, Israeli media reported.



The prosecution charged he posed "a real danger to the security of Israel," while the judges stressed the 56-year-old former nuclear technician had contacts with unspecified "foreign elements."



Israel is widely believed to be the only nuclear-armed power in the Middle East, with between 100 and 300 warheads, but it has a policy of neither confirming nor denying that. The Jewish state has refused to sign the n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ty or to allow international surveillance of its Dimona plant in the Negev desert of southern Israel.

Here are some of the prohibitions that are placed upon Vanunu after his release from jail.

he shall not be able to have contacts with citizens of other countries but Israel
he shall not use phones
he shall not own cellullar phones
he shall not have access to the Internet
he shall not approach or enter embassies and consulates
he shall not come within 500 metres of any international border crossing
he shall not visit any port of entry and airport
he shall not leave the State of Israel

It seems like you're asking two questions. 1) Could his nuclear knowledge still be sensitive after 25 years? And 2) If so, is he likely to reveal it?

I have only looked at your sources, but it seems the answer to 2) is clearly yes. He doesn't seem to want to live within Israeli law even today.

He was released in 2004 but banned from travel or contact with foreigners without prior permission. He has since been sanctioned more than 20 times for breaking the rules.
More than 20 times in seven years? Yeah, he's a risk.

But question 1) is a little trickier. I would expect that some nuclear principles haven't changed in 25 years. The details of the Dimona site are probably the same as when he was there. The US, I believe, has a 30-year rule. I suppose the information could still be sensitive.

Israel may be wrong here, I don't know, but I don't see that they're being wildly unreasonable.
